About the Opportunity

Join the team as a Hospital Assistant – Cleaner at the Calvary MaterHospitaland play an important roleinmaintaininga clean,safeand welcoming environment for patients,visitorsand staff. You will contribute to the delivery of quality cleaning services across clinical and non-clinical areas,in accordance withNSW Health Cleaning Service Standards, Guidelines and Policy.

About the Role

- Carry out cleaning duties across clinical and non-clinical departmentsin accordance withthe relevant Service Plan.
- Clean surfaces, fittings,fixturesand furniture using a range of equipment, including vacuum cleaners,laddersand scrubbers.
- Clean immediate patient environments, including infectious and isolation rooms.
- Remove bags of soiled linen and waste to collection points and undertake manual handling tasks such as moving equipment and stores, pushingtrolleysand mopping floors.
- Maintain relevant records and complete documentation associated with cleaning duties, including ordering consumables.
- Work collaboratively with team members tomaintainopen communication and ensure service requirements and standards are consistently met.
- Participate in staff meetings and training while on duty.
- Adhere to NSW Health and local policies and procedures and follow reasonable directions from the Environmental Services Manager, Supervisor or Team Leaders.

About You

We are looking for someone who:

- Works effectively as part of a team and is committed to delivering quality services.
- Haspreviouscleaning experience in a healthcare, commercial or industrial setting, ordemonstratedability to perform in the role.
- Hasgood communicationand interpersonal skills.
- Understands work health and safety principles, including safe manual handling and infection control.




- Has good timemanagement skills and can organise their workload andidentifycritical priorities.
- Has basic computer skills and the ability to complete mandatory training requirements, including face-to-face and online units.
